Lavender review
Lavender helps SDRs and founders write clearer, shorter, and more personalized sales emails with coaching inside the drafting process.
AI email coach for better cold outreach and follow-up copy.
Teams trying to improve cold email quality without building a custom workflow.
Pros
- Strong outreach coaching
- Simple workflow
- Helpful for reps
Cons
- Narrower scope than a full GTM platform
- Personalization still needs judgment

What is Lavender best for?
Lavender is best for teams trying to improve cold email quality without building a custom workflow. It is usually considered in sales workflows where teams want help with sales, cold email, personalization.
Is Lavender free or paid?
Lavender uses a freemium pricing model. The starting point listed on this page is Free plan available.
